They actually aren't - 2checkout simply supports authorize.net's parameters, or at least that is what I understand.

There are no plans to add any further _individual_ merchant plugins to Jamroom - what we're looking at doing is integrating with Shopify:

http://www.shopify.com/

which gives us instant support for over 25 different payment processors. I'm still doing some investigation on if it is fully going to work or not, but at this point that is the goal.

Integrating payment gateways are probably the most time consuming development effort you can do in Jamroom - each one is completely different then every other one, so you end up with A LOT of new code and testing, so it can be expensive to develop. To be honest, I'm no longer 100% sure of this - at one point 2checkout would support authorize.net parameters - that was to help ease the transition of users leaving Authorize.net and coming over to 2checkout. However, I don't believe it goes the other way (although at one point this did seem to be the case).

We're actually moving away from supporting 2checkout, since they've shut down (out of the blue) several Jamroom sites in the past due to their (incorrect) belief that the sites were offering "pirated music":

https://www2.2checkout.com/documentation/prohibited.html

2checkout seems to be against allowing most Social Media sites as well - they'll find a reason to block you.

So in summary, at this time there's really no support for Authorize.net.
